diff --git a/src/scripts/mypreferencescommon.js b/src/scripts/mypreferencescommon.js index ca800dfbb1..accbae3784 100644 --- a/src/scripts/mypreferencescommon.js +++ b/src/scripts/mypreferencescommon.js @@ -16,15 +16,27 @@ define(["apphost", "connectionManager", "listViewStyle", "emby-linkbutton"], fun page.querySelector(".lnkHomeScreenPreferences").setAttribute("href", "mypreferenceshome.html?userId=" + userId); page.querySelector(".lnkMyProfile").setAttribute("href", "myprofile.html?userId=" + userId); - appHost.supports("multiserver") ? page.querySelector(".selectServer").classList.remove("hide") : page.querySelector(".selectServer").classList.add("hide"); + if (appHost.supports("multiserver")) { + page.querySelector(".selectServer").classList.remove("hide") + } else { + page.querySelector(".selectServer").classList.add("hide"); + } connectionManager.user(ApiClient).then(function(user) { - user.localUser && !user.localUser.EnableAutoLogin ? view.querySelector(".btnLogout").classList.remove("hide") : view.querySelector(".btnLogout").classList.add("hide"); + if (user.localUser && !user.localUser.EnableAutoLogin) { + view.querySelector(".btnLogout").classList.remove("hide"); + } else { + view.querySelector(".btnLogout").classList.add("hide"); + } }); Dashboard.getCurrentUser().then(function(user) { page.querySelector(".headerUser").innerHTML = user.Name; - user.Policy.IsAdministrator ? page.querySelector(".adminSection").classList.remove("hide") : page.querySelector(".adminSection").classList.add("hide"); + if (user.Policy.IsAdministrator) { + page.querySelector(".adminSection").classList.remove("hide"); + } else { + page.querySelector(".adminSection").classList.add("hide"); + } }); }) } -}); \ No newline at end of file +}); diff --git a/src/scripts/selectserver.js b/src/scripts/selectserver.js index 8f0bf59759..036f66254c 100644 --- a/src/scripts/selectserver.js +++ b/src/scripts/selectserver.js @@ -122,7 +122,7 @@ define(["loading", "appRouter", "layoutManager", "appSettings", "apphost", "focu var isRestored = e.detail.isRestored; appRouter.setTitle(null); backdrop.setBackdrop(backdropUrl); - isRestored || loadServers(); + if (!isRestored) loadServers(); }), view.querySelector(".servers").addEventListener("click", function(e) { var card = dom.parentWithClass(e.target, "card"); if (card) { diff --git a/src/scripts/site.js b/src/scripts/site.js index d4b0c3df35..91c6edeed5 100644 --- a/src/scripts/site.js +++ b/src/scripts/site.js @@ -307,11 +307,9 @@ var Dashboard = { : browser.msie ? define("registerElement", [bowerPath + "/webcomponentsjs/webcomponents-lite.min.js"], returnFirstDependency) : define("registerElement", [bowerPath + "/document-register-element/build/document-register-element"], returnFirstDependency); - "android" === self.appMode + "cordova" === self.appMode || "android" === self.appMode ? define("serverdiscovery", ["cordova/serverdiscovery"], returnFirstDependency) - : "cordova" === self.appMode - ? define("serverdiscovery", ["cordova/serverdiscovery"], returnFirstDependency) - : define("serverdiscovery", [apiClientBowerPath + "/serverdiscovery"], returnFirstDependency); + : define("serverdiscovery", [apiClientBowerPath + "/serverdiscovery"], returnFirstDependency); "cordova" === self.appMode && browser.iOSVersion && browser.iOSVersion < 11 ? define("imageFetcher", ["cordova/imagestore"], returnFirstDependency) : define("imageFetcher", [embyWebComponentsBowerPath + "/images/basicimagefetcher"], returnFirstDependency);